Music is...
Music is everywhere. There is no place in the world that does not have some form for music. Unquestionably, it is essential to society, and therefore, it is critical to learn about the different world cultures and their music. Further, music reflects the way people think, the way they act, and the way musicians and audience members connect with each other. Music helps define identities. Music not only helps establish the identity of an individual, but it also helps establish the identities of communities. Music shapes social structures within societies and the behaviors of people. Therefore, music is universal. Music is a common language, so all people must take time to understand the music around them in order to see the powerful harmonic connection that is taking place between all human beings. Music is communication. Definitely, it helps people connect with others around them. Most important, music is a symbol and an agent of identity for many.
